Well I pulled out the cars tonight to get some numbers. Here they are
Car 1 5oz, 1"COM (thought it was shorter), 5 3/8 Wheelbase
Car 2 6oz, 1" COM, 5 1/4 Wheelbase
Car 3 5oz, 13/16 COM, 4 3/4 Wheelbase
car 1 and 3 are same design, just flipped DFW from right to left just because. car 2 is a slight wedge design. All three cars have canted rear wheels (drilled canted), car 1 and 2 have 1.5 degree DFW, and car 3 has a 2.5 degree DFW.
car 1 best run was a 3.3323, car 3 best run I saw as a 3.3841, car 2 best run was about a 3.39.
My problems that I saw when looking at the cars tonight, first I did not press the axles in enough on any of the cars. If i pusht he wheel up against the body there is a big gap from the underside of the axle head in the outer hub hole. I can only imagine how much time I lost on each car just from the movement back and forth of the wheel. Next I looked close and did a spin test on the rear wheels, all are very quiet even with that big gap, next I did a spin test on the DFW, on car 1 It looks like I did not provide enough clearence and with that movement the wheel can actually com in contact with the body of the car on the inner edge, it was still quiet. Wow I wonder how much time that cost the car with that touching. Last on car 2 the DFW was very noisy. So with all this being said my plans before district are to 1 trim car 1 around the wheel so i have no possible contact. 2 press the axles in more (how much?), 3 repolish the wheels and axles, specificly on car 2 as that DFW sounded like a horrible mess.
